Output 59fbbffcd301510c0940263bcc5cc85f414bf1f2379f314bf48045c0482f26f5:1

value
5622977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43dd40953d2e69a14fc769826768cb234614635e OP_EQUAL
address
37srFGrP9Wgx52FKeT27H37rByJtvupoxo
transaction
59fbbffcd301510c0940263bcc5cc85f414bf1f2379f314bf48045c0482f26f5
spent
true